What is the meaning of Sarcrams?

Full Definition of sarcasm 1 : a sharp and often satirical or ironic utterance designed to cut or give pain. 2a : a mode of satirical wit depending for its effect on bitter, caustic, and often ironic language that is usually directed against an individual.

What is a sacrum?

The sacrum is a shield-shaped bony structure that is located at the base of the lumbar vertebrae and that is connected to the pelvis. Joined at the very end of the sacrum are two to four tiny, partially fused vertebrae known as the coccyx or “tail bone”.

What is coccyx?

What is the tailbone/coccyx? Your coccyx is made up of three to five fused vertebrae (bones). It lies beneath the sacrum, a bone structure at the base of your spine. Several tendons, muscles and ligaments connect to it.

Which is an example of a sarcastic joke?

Sarcastic jokes can also be used for comedic relief. For example, “I walked into my hotel room and wondered if the interior decorators thought orange was the new black.” The main gist of sarcasm is that the words are not meant to be taken literally. Sarcasm can come in all different types.

Is sarcasm the same as irony? Sarcasm refers to the use of words that mean the opposite of what you really want to say, especially in order to insult someone, or to show irritation, or just to be funny. For example, saying “they’re really on top of things” to describe a group of people who are very disorganized is using sarcasm.
